Which of the following is not true regarding RNA?
RNA is made by transcribing DNA
RNA is single stranded
RNA nucleotides contain one deoxyribose sugar
RNA nucleotides contain one ribose sugar
RNA contains uracil instead of thymine
RNA nucleotides contain one deoxyribose sugar
RNA stands for ribonucleic acid, and each RNA nucleotide contains one phosphate, one nitrogenous base (either adenine, uracil, cytosine, or guanine), and one ribose sugar. RNA does not contain a deoxyribose sugar as seen in DNA.

A DNA sequence is read in the 5' to 3' direction, whats do these numbers refer to?
The linkages between the sugar and the nitrogenous base
The location of the all the thymine bases
The linkages between the phosphate group and the nitrogenous base
The linkages between the phosphate group and the sugar
The direction of the turn of the DNA helix
The linkages between the phosphate group and the sugar
Nucleotides are linked together to form nucleic acids by bonds between the phosphate groups and ribose sugars. A phosphate group is bonded the 5' carbon of one ribose and the 3' carbon of the next ribose, leading to the 5' to 3 directionality of DNA.

What are the three parts of a nucleotide?
A glycerol head and a fatty acid tail
Afive-carbon sugar, a phosphate group, and a nitrogenous base
A five-carbon sugar, a phosphate group, and a carbon-hydrogen chain
A glycerol/phosphate head and nitrogenous base
Afive-carbon sugar, a phosphate group, and a nitrogenous base
A nucleotide is made up of a 5-carbon sugar, a phosphate group, and a nitrogenous base. Lipids consist of a glycerol and fatty acid chains
